People in the News: David Wellis, Ramona Walker, Leslie Auld

David Wellis has been named CEO of the San Diego Blood Bank. Wellis was previously president of BioAlta, president and CEO of GenVault, and in charge of product marketing at Illumina.

He replaces outgoing CEO Ramona Walker, who is retiring.


GeneNews has appointed Leslie Auld to serve on its board of directors. Auld is GeneNews' chief financial officer and has been with the company since 2010. She previously worked at Luminex Diagnostics as senior director of finance.
